  10. MY bike runs good for the most part but I want a few more opinions on where to be on mains, pilot especially, and needle position. I have DMC 2:1 pipes, no airbox with a uni filter, v-force reeds, +4 timing advance, 50:1 premix, and as of now I have 320 mains, needle clip 2nd position, and 30 pilot. I'm not sure on my elevation in southwest Missouri. Temp is about 30 to 60 degrees about now. If it runs shitty at all its from 0 to 1/4 throttle. Been tuning slowly. Just wanted more opinions. Thanx for all the input.
